Jianrui Lyu submitted the

                 pegmatch

package.

Version:  2025B 2025-02-16
License:  lppl1.3c

Summary description:  Parsing Expression Grammars for TeX

Announcement text:
----------------------------------------------------------------------
 
 This pegmatch package ports PEG (Parsing Expression Grammars) to TeX.
 Following the design in LPEG (Parsing Expression Grammars for Lua),
 it defines patterns as LaTeX3 variables, and offers several operators
 to compose patterns.
 In general, PEG matching is much more powerful than RE (Regular
 Expressions) matching.
